John S. Van Arnam is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, John S. Van Arnam has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 686 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Oncology and 3 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in John S. Van Arnam’s work include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(2 papers),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(2 papers) and Mesenchymal stem cell research (2 papers). John S. Van Arnam is often cited by papers focused on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(2 papers),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(2 papers) and Mesenchymal stem cell research (2 papers). John S. Van Arnam coll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Australia. John S. Van Arnam's co-authors include Joanna E. Grove, May Kihara, Robert M. Macnab, Erica L. Herzog and Jonathan L. McMurry and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Nature Communications and Blood.
